Class XpsCanvas
اسم الفضاء : Aspose.Page.XPS.XpsModel تجميع: Aspose.Page.dll (25.4.0)
تخصيص العناصر المضغوطة من الدرجة.هذه العناصر تجمع بين العناصر معا.على سبيل المثال، Glyphs و Path العناصريمكن تجميعها في قناة لتحديدها كوحدة (كوجهة الارتباط) أوتطبيق قيمة الممتلكات المركبة على كل طفل وعنصر الأجداد.
public sealed class XpsCanvas : XpsContentElement, IEnumerable<xpscontentelement>, IEnumerable
Inheritance
object ← XpsObject ← XpsElement ← XpsHyperlinkElement ← XpsContentElement ← XpsCanvas
Implements
الأعضاء الموروثين
XpsContentElement.RenderTransform , XpsContentElement.Clip , XpsContentElement.Opacity , XpsContentElement.OpacityMask , XpsHyperlinkElement.HyperlinkTarget , XpsElement.GetEnumerator() , XpsElement.this[int] , XpsElement.Count , object.GetType()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Properties
EdgeMode
إرجاع / إعداد القيمة التي تسيطر على كيفية إرجاع حواف الطرق داخل المراحيض.
public XpsEdgeMode EdgeMode { get; set; }
قيمة الممتلكات
Methods
إضافة t>(T)
أضف عنصرًا إلى قائمة الأطفال لهذا القناة.
public T Add<t>(T element) where T : XpsContentElement
Parameters
element
T
العنصر الذي سيتم إضافته.
Returns
T
إضافة العنصر
نوع المعلمات
T
نوع العنصر الذي يجب إضافته.
AddCanvas()
إضافة قناة جديدة إلى قائمة الأطفال لهذا القناة.
public XpsCanvas AddCanvas()
Returns
إضافة القنابل .
AddGlyphs(الشريط، السفينة، FontStyle، الطائرات، الموجة، سلاسل)
إضافة غليفات جديدة إلى قائمة الأطفال لهذا القناة.
public XpsGlyphs AddGlyphs(string fontFamily, float fontSize, FontStyle fontStyle, float originX, float originY, string unicodeString)
Parameters
fontFamily
string
اسم العائلة .
fontSize
float
حجم الخط.
fontStyle
FontStyle
النمط الصوتي
originX
float
أصل Glyphs هو إحداثيات X.
originY
float
أصل Glyphs T coordinate.
unicodeString
string
قوس قزح للطباعة
Returns
أضف غليف
AddPath(XpsPathGeometry)
أضف مسارًا جديدًا إلى قائمة الأطفال لهذا القناة.
public XpsPath AddPath(XpsPathGeometry data)
Parameters
data
XpsPathGeometry
جغرافيا الطريق .
Returns
مسار إضافي
Clone()
استنساخ هذا القنب.
public XpsCanvas Clone()
Returns
الكلون من هذا القنب.
إدخال t>(ت ت ت ت ت)
أدخل عنصرًا في قائمة أطفال هذا القناة في index’ position.
public T Insert<t>(int index, T element) where T : XpsContentElement
Parameters
index
int
الموقع الذي ينبغي إدخال عنصر.
element
T
العنصر الذي يجب إدخاله.
Returns
T
إدخال العنصر
نوع المعلمات
T
نوع العنصر الذي يجب إضافته.
InsertCanvas(إنت)
إدخال قناة جديدة في قائمة الأطفال لهذا القناة في index’ position.
public XpsCanvas InsertCanvas(int index)
Parameters
index
int
الموقع الذي ينبغي إدخال قنبلة جديدة.
Returns
إدخال القنابل
InsertGlyphs(int, string, float, FontStyle, flate, fleat، string)
قم بإدخال غليفات جديدة في قائمة أطفال هذا القماش في index’ position.
public XpsGlyphs InsertGlyphs(int index, string fontFamily, float fontSize, FontStyle fontStyle, float originX, float originY, string unicodeString)
Parameters
index
int
الموقع الذي ينبغي إدخال الجليف الجديد.
fontFamily
string
اسم العائلة .
fontSize
float
حجم الخط.
fontStyle
FontStyle
النمط الصوتي
originX
float
أصل Glyphs هو إحداثيات X.
originY
float
أصل Glyphs T coordinate.
unicodeString
string
قوس قزح للطباعة
Returns
أضف غليف
InsertPath(إنت، XpsPathجيومتر)
أدخل مسارًا جديدًا إلى قائمة أطفال هذا القناة في index’ position.
public XpsPath InsertPath(int index, XpsPathGeometry data)
Parameters
index
int
الموقف الذي ينبغي إدخال مسار جديد.
data
XpsPathGeometry
جغرافيا الطريق .
Returns
مسار إدخال